Agile methodology is a project management and product development approach that
emphasizes flexibility, collaboration, and customer-centricity. It originated in the software
development industry but has since been adopted across various sectors due to its
effectiveness in managing complex projects. At its core, Agile promotes iterative
progress through small, manageable increments, allowing teams to adapt to changes
quickly and efficiently. Understanding the principles and practices of Agile is essential
for quality managers and analysts who aim to create robust quality control plans that
align with Agile frameworks.
